Mumbai, June 13 (NationPress) Actress Kritika Kamra, who has recently completed filming for Anusha Rizvi’s forthcoming project in Delhi, expressed that it was “incredibly special” to be on a set where women play roles beyond just being in front of the camera.
The film showcases a remarkable ensemble of female talent, including Juhu Babbar, Shreya Dhanwanthary, and many other experienced women actors, with women also holding significant positions behind the scenes.
Kritika remarked: “It’s incredibly special to find yourself on a set where women are not only in front of the camera but are leading every aspect, from direction to production and costumes. Collaborating with Anusha Rizvi was genuinely a gift.”
Over the years, the actress has had the opportunity to work alongside some incredible female talents both on and off the screen.
She further added: “With this film, Anusha brings such a powerful vision and a truly open environment for collaboration. There’s a unique energy when strong women unite like this; it’s nurturing, inspiring, and profoundly enriching. We weren’t merely telling a story; we were sharing lived experiences, supporting, and uplifting one another.”
“This has always been my experience in collaborations with women. I feel extremely fortunate to have been part of something so extraordinary.”
The project, which is yet to be titled, was filmed extensively in Delhi and is currently undergoing post-production.
Kritika is also part of Matka King, featuring Vijay Varma.
Directed by Nagraj Manjule, known for “Sairat” and “Fandry”, Matka King narrates a tale set in the gritty backdrop of 1960s Mumbai.
The series is anticipated to explore the journey of an ambitious cotton trader in Mumbai who initiates a new gambling game called Matka, which revolutionizes the city and makes a previously exclusive domain accessible to all.
The series also includes Sai Tamhankar, Gulshan Grover, and Siddharth Jadhav in prominent roles, among others. Written by Abhay Koranne and Nagraj Manjule, this project is produced by Siddharth Roy Kapur and Manjule, along with Gargi Kulkarni, Ashish Aryan, and Ashwini Sidwani, under the banner of Roy Kapur Films.
